About
ITA Airways is Italy's national flag carrier, established in 2020 as the successor to Alitalia. Co-owned by the Italian Ministry of Economy and Finance and Lufthansa Group, it operates a modern, predominantly Airbus fleet. ITA Airways serves over 70 domestic, European, and intercontinental destinations, with its main hub at Rome Fiumicino Airport. The airline offers Economy, Premium Economy, and Business Class, with complimentary meals and in-flight Wi-Fi on many routes. ITA Airways was a SkyTeam member until April 2025 and is expected to join Star Alliance in the first half of 2026.

About
Ryanair is one of Europe’s largest and most popular low-cost airlines, headquartered in Ireland. It offers affordable flights to destinations across the continent, often operating to smaller or secondary airports outside major cities to keep fares low. All Ryanair tickets include an allowance for one small personal bag, with additional fees for cabin baggage and checked luggage. Known for its extensive network and budget-friendly fares, Ryanair makes it easy to travel quickly and affordably to popular European destinations.

The best events to attend in Taormina include:
  • Taormina Film Fest, an annual film festival showcasing international cinema
  • Greek Theatre Festival, a celebration of ancient Greek drama performed in the historic theatre
  • Taormina Arte, a series of cultural events including music, dance, and theater performances
  • Feast of St. Nicholas, a religious festival featuring processions and local traditions.
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Taormina are:
  • Ancient Theatre of Taormina, a well-preserved Greco-Roman theater offering panoramic views of the sea and Mount Etna
  • Isola Bella, a picturesque island and nature reserve connected to the mainland by a narrow path
  • Corso Umberto, the main pedestrian street lined with shops, cafes, and historic buildings
  • Villa Comunale, a public garden with exotic plants and stunning views of the coastline
  • Palazzo Corvaja, a medieval palace showcasing a blend of Arab, Norman, and Gothic architectural styles.
The best holidays to experience in Taormina include:
  • Easter, pleasant spring weather and traditional local celebrations
  • Ferragosto, a national holiday in August with beach festivities and local feasts
  • Christmas, beautiful decorations and festive markets throughout the city.
The best things to do in Taormina include:
  • Taormina Cable Car, providing scenic rides between the town center and the beaches below
  • Explore the local cuisine with a cooking class, learning to make traditional Sicilian dishes
  • Visit the nearby Alcantara Gorge, known for its impressive rock formations and natural beauty
  • Enjoy a wine tasting tour in the surrounding vineyards, sampling local Sicilian wines
  • Take a boat tour around the coast, offering unique views of Taormina and its surroundings.

Currently, UK citizens do not need a visa for short stays (up to 90 days in a 180-day period) for tourism or business in the Schengen Area. However, the new ETIAS (European Travel Information and Authorisation System) is scheduled to launch in late 2026. Once active, this digital travel authorization will be a mandatory pre-travel requirement for all UK passport holders.
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e.g., 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s).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you.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
Italy u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most payments,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small shops,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Taormina,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like the historic center and near popular attractions. Be wary of unofficial taxi drivers who may overcharge or take longer routes. Additionally, avoid street vendors selling counterfeit goods or offering unsolicited services. Staying alert and using authorized transportation and reputable vendors helps ensure a safe visit.
